About Our Chimney Relining
Chimney relining is a specialized process that involves replacing or repairing the inner lining of your chimney flue. This lining is essential for directing smoke and gases safely out of your home, as well as protecting the chimney structure from the corrosive effects of combustion byproducts. Over time, factors such as age, weather, and the materials used can lead to cracks, gaps, or complete deterioration of the lining, which can pose serious safety risks. Homeowners may notice signs such as a strong odor, smoke backing up into the home, or even visible damage to the chimney structure itself. If you experience any of these issues, it’s crucial to act quickly and seek professional chimney relining services.
The relining process typically begins with a thorough inspection of your chimney. Once we have a clear understanding of the necessary repairs, we will recommend the most suitable relining solution, which may include stainless steel liners, clay tiles, or cast-in-place liners, depending on your specific needs and the existing structure of your chimney.
Choosing to have your chimney relined by professionals not only ensures the safety of your home but also enhances the efficiency of your fireplace or heating system. A properly lined chimney improves airflow, allowing your fireplace to burn more efficiently and reducing the risk of creosote buildup, which can lead to chimney fires. Additionally, a new liner can increase the lifespan of your chimney, saving you money on future repairs and replacements.

Frequently Asked Questions About Chimney Relining
How often should I consider chimney relining?
It’s recommended to have your chimney inspected every year, and relining may be necessary if cracks or deterioration are found.
What materials do you use for chimney relining?
We offer a variety of materials including stainless steel, clay tiles, and cast-in-place liners, tailored to your chimney's specific needs.
Will relining my chimney improve its performance?
Yes, relining enhances airflow and efficiency, leading to better heating and reduced risks of creosote buildup.
